Analysis
The most recent figure for roundwood — export quantity, per capita in Bangladesh is 0 m3 per person, measured in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 285.8% on the previous year and down 60.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, roundwood — export quantity, per capita in Bangladesh peaked at 0.001 m3 per person in 1998 and was at its lowest, 0 m3 per person, in 2001.
That places Bangladesh 131st out of 183 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Roundwood — Export quantity div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Roundwood — Export quantity 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Roundwood — Export quantity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
